Removing Calcium Deposits from Your Refrigerator’s Water Dispenser

Posted on 10 March 2025 By Redactor

Calcium deposits in your refrigerator’s water dispenser are a common nuisance․ These unsightly white spots not only detract from the appliance’s aesthetic appeal but can also affect the taste of your water․ Fortunately, removing these mineral build-ups is achievable with a few simple techniques and readily available household items․ This comprehensive guide will walk you through various methods, ensuring you achieve sparkling clean results and restore the pristine condition of your water dispenser․ Let’s dive into the effective solutions․

Understanding Calcium Deposits

Before tackling the removal process, it’s helpful to understand what causes these pesky deposits․ Hard water, which is rich in minerals like calcium and magnesium, is the primary culprit․ As water flows through your dispenser, these minerals gradually accumulate, leaving behind a chalky residue․ The frequency of cleaning depends on the hardness of your water; areas with hard water will require more frequent cleaning than those with soft water․ Over time, these deposits can become quite stubborn, making removal more challenging․

Factors Affecting Calcium Buildup

Several factors contribute to the rate of calcium accumulation in your water dispenser․ The mineral content of your water supply plays a significant role; the higher the mineral content, the faster the build-up․ The frequency of water dispenser usage also matters; more frequent use leads to more exposure to minerals, resulting in faster accumulation․ Finally, the design of your water dispenser itself can influence the rate of calcium buildup․ Some designs are more prone to trapping minerals than others․

Methods for Removing Calcium Deposits

There are several effective methods for removing calcium deposits, ranging from simple home remedies to more specialized cleaning solutions․ Choosing the right method depends on the severity of the build-up and your personal preferences․ Remember to always consult your refrigerator’s manual before attempting any cleaning method to avoid damaging your appliance․

Method 1: White Vinegar Solution

White vinegar is a natural and effective cleaning agent․ Its acidity helps dissolve calcium deposits․ Simply mix equal parts white vinegar and water in a bowl․ Using a soft cloth or sponge, apply the solution to the affected areas of the water dispenser․ Let it sit for 15-20 minutes to allow the vinegar to work its magic․ Then, gently scrub the area with a soft brush or sponge․ Finally, rinse thoroughly with clean water and wipe dry․

Method 2: Lemon Juice Solution

Similar to white vinegar, lemon juice is a natural acidic solution that can effectively dissolve calcium deposits․ Its mild acidity is gentler than vinegar, making it suitable for more delicate surfaces․ Follow the same procedure as with the vinegar solution: Mix equal parts lemon juice and water, apply to the affected areas, let it sit for 15-20 minutes, scrub gently, and rinse thoroughly․

Method 3: Commercial Descaling Solutions

If home remedies prove ineffective, consider using a commercial descaling solution specifically designed for removing mineral deposits from appliances․ These solutions are generally more potent than vinegar or lemon juice and can effectively tackle stubborn calcium build-up․ Always follow the manufacturer’s instructions carefully to ensure safe and effective use․ Remember to thoroughly rinse the dispenser after using any commercial cleaning product․

Preventing Future Calcium Buildup

Preventing calcium deposits is just as important as removing them․ Regular cleaning can significantly reduce the build-up of minerals․ The frequency of cleaning will depend on the hardness of your water․ Regularly wiping down the dispenser with a damp cloth after each use can help prevent mineral accumulation․ Consider installing a water filter to reduce the mineral content of your water supply․ This can significantly reduce the rate of calcium deposit formation․

Tips for Prevention

  • Clean the dispenser regularly, at least once a month․
  • Wipe down the dispenser after each use․
  • Install a water filter to reduce mineral content․
  • Use distilled water if possible․
  • Avoid leaving stagnant water in the dispenser․

Addressing Stubborn Deposits

If you’re dealing with particularly stubborn calcium deposits, you may need to repeat the cleaning process or try a different method․ For extremely stubborn build-ups, soaking the removable parts of the dispenser in a vinegar or commercial descaling solution overnight might be necessary․ Always ensure that the parts are compatible with the cleaning solution you are using․ If you’re unsure, consult your refrigerator’s manual or contact a professional․

Advanced Cleaning Techniques

In some cases, you might need to resort to more advanced cleaning techniques․ Using a soft-bristled brush or a toothbrush to gently scrub away the deposits can be helpful․ For hard-to-reach areas, consider using cotton swabs or small cleaning tools․ Remember to be gentle to avoid scratching the surface of the dispenser․ If you are still facing difficulty, it might be advisable to consult a refrigerator repair professional․
